The FB3G280-48PL-20 is a high-performance 280mm DC centrifugal blower designed for industrial ventilation systems. Operating at 48V DC with 395W power consumption, it delivers 3084 m³/h max airflow at 777 Pa static pressure while maintaining 78 dB(A) noise levels. Featuring IP44 protection and wide voltage tolerance (36-57V DC), it excels in demanding applications requiring robust airflow and energy efficiency.
Industrial-Grade Airflow
3084 m³/h airflow capacity with 777 Pa static pressure - ideal for ducted systems with high resistance.
Energy-Efficient DC Drive
395W power consumption with 36-57V wide input range, saving 20% energy vs. AC equivalents.
Vibration-Optimized Design
6-blade glass-fiber reinforced impeller with G6.3 dynamic balancing ensures smooth operation at 2610 RPM.
Precision Control Interface
Standard 0-10VDC/PWM input + FG tach signal (3 pulses/revolution) for accurate speed regulation.
Environmental Resilience
IP44 protection against dust/water splashes; operates from -25°C to 60°C.
